Framing and envelope transition occurs at an entry column with an aluminum curtain wall and storefront system. The assembly integrates a structural column wrapped in fireproofing, surrounded by 3 5/8-inch and 6-inch metal stud walls with spray foam insulation and 5/8-inch fire-retardant treated plywood in lieu of gypsum board. Exterior finishes include a 2-inch composite metal wall panel system, a 2-inch SIS panel with air and water-resistant barrier, and metal flashing with backer rod and sealant at the aluminum curtain wall joints. A decorative seal stone sill is positioned per the finish plan above a concrete stem wall below.
